Southsea Folk, Roots & Blues Festival

I’ve literally just found out about this when asked if I knew what was happening. I couldn’t find much info aside from the dates and times, but The NEWS had a few words to say so I cheekily pinched them.

“The 2011 Festival will feature top acts, many of them local, including Jackie Leven, The Marvels, Little Johnny England, Jigantics, ColvinQuarmby, Reet Petite & Gone and the Aynsley Lister Band. Pub fringe events will be provided by Andy Broad’s Festival Blues Jam, Robin Bibi, The Jellyrollers and Sons of the Delta.

Afternoon concerts will be held at the Club on Saturday, Sunday and Monday over the Bank Holiday weekend. Evening concerts will be held on the Friday, Saturday, Sunday and Monday.

One of the strengths of The Southsea Folk & Roots Festival has been in recognising the wealth of local talent we have in our area. The Festival wouldn’t have been the same without appearances by local heroes such as The News Awards winner Chris Ricketts, Ade Cull, Arlen, Legacy, Andy Broad, Apicella, Mary Jane, Hard Times String Band, The Jellyrollers, Father Jack, Dan Ogus, Della Perrett’s Sweetedge, White Knuckle Blues Band, The Continentals, Burnt Ice and many, many others.”
